2014-03-01 70 views
-3

我有一個在Arduino uno上燒燬的代碼,我想要得到這個代碼的十六進制文件嗎?!獲取Arduino閃存的內容

我該怎麼做?!

+0

獲取零件的數據表,它說明了如何讀取和/或寫入舞會...... –

回答

0

在這個論壇它說,你可以從Arduino的代碼解壓到您的計算機,但它會在可執行的代碼,你不能編輯(它可能會更快重寫程序)

http://forum.arduino.cc/index.php/topic,48218.0.html

+0

該問題僅詢問有關將內容作爲十六進制文件進行檢索的問題,因此看起來正是所需要的。 – Clifford

0

如果您有合適的hardware/software,則可以通過ISP(如果尚未禁用)從AVR讀取閃存。您可以使用another Arduino構建硬件,在avrdude中使用「avrisp」作爲ISP接口設備ID。

不要禁用AVR的SPI端口的電源 - 這也會禁用ISP接口(相同的引腳),並且如果您沒有工作的引導加載程序來加載代碼以再次啓用,則永久鎖定您!